The SEC has announced a new project that may change the rules for cryptocurrencies, particularly XRP. Project Crypto aims to develop clear regulations.
SEC's Regulatory Initiatives and Market Reactions
On July 31, 2025, SEC Chairman Paul Atkins announced the launch of 'Project Crypto' at the America First Policy Institute event. This initiative may lead to a change in the status of most crypto assets, including XRP, and positively impact their market stability.
